ECOWAS Court to Rule on Demolition of Church at KASU by El-Rufai’s Administration

By Achadu Gabriel, Kaduna

The ECOWAS Community Court of Justice** in Abuja has begun hearing a lawsuit filed by Reverend Joseph Hayab, former Chairman of the Christian Association of Nigeria (CAN), Kaduna State**, against the Federal Government of Nigeria** over the demolition of a church at Kaduna State University (KASU).

The suit (ECW/CCJ/APP/40/23)**, filed in **October 2023, came up for hearing on Friday, February 28, 2025, in Abuja. Reverend Hayab is challenging the demolition of the only church on KASU’s main campus, allegedly carried out under the administration of former Governor Mallam Nasir El-Rufai.

In addition, the Kaduna State Government was accused of attempting to forcibly take over the Chapel of Goodnews**, which shares a fence with the university but has a separate ownership structure.
